Output e0da2a589288f5ac24169f42d7e54a4b035145e4fcb15d03ac5960df50fc75b5:1

value
45912115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b40f04ea755555b3f5f048ce4cfe72023216c3 OP_EQUAL
address
36VgmDQ4WQN8KrYGs7McoYdtibLSzgwNe3
transaction
e0da2a589288f5ac24169f42d7e54a4b035145e4fcb15d03ac5960df50fc75b5
confirmations
317198
spent
true